> After some discussions on IRC, it seems safer to do the following:
> 1. first read the qemu,mem-bar-min-align property and use that for alignment;
> 2. if no property is present, than default to 64K.
>
> This should work assuming that normally newer SLOF should not appear in
> real world together with old QEMU (so we do not change old QEMU behaviour),
> and this SLOF change is targeted for QEMU v2.10, and one way or another we
> will address BAR alignment in QEMU in that timeframe - QEMU will either put
> a property to the device tree (64k for new machines and 1 for old machines)
> or just do BAR allocation.
>
> If you agree, could you make another patch combining the property and 64k
> default? If not, speak :) Thanks!
This is somewhat opposed to David's concerns WRT requiring new
device-tree properties to maintain current behavior, instead of the
opposite. But if it's under the understanding that we do plan to address
this on the QEMU side in a way that won't require such a property (by
doing BAR assignment in QEMU as you mentioned), then perhaps this
approach is acceptable... the property would only be a last-resort.
